欢迎光临略阳翁爱格网络有限公司司官网!
全国咨询热线:13121005431
当前位置: 首页 > 新闻动态

c++怎么使用智能指针_C++智能指针shared_ptr与unique_ptr使用详解

时间:2025-11-28 15:53:06

c++怎么使用智能指针_C++智能指针shared_ptr与unique_ptr使用详解
虽然不需要手动操作vtable,但了解它能让调试和性能优化更有方向。
在PHP中提取颜色代码(如十六进制颜色值 #FFFFFF、#abc 等)是常见的需求,比如处理CSS样式、用户输入或主题配置。
挖错网 一款支持文本、图片、视频纠错和AIGC检测的内容审核校对平台。
核心策略:基于索引的pd.concat合并 使用pd.concat进行基于日期时间列的合并,其核心策略是: set_index(): 将DataFrame中作为合并键的日期时间列设置为DataFrame的索引。
C++中交换数组的方法包括:①std::array用std::swap实现O(1)交换;②C风格数组需循环逐元素交换,时间复杂度O(n);③std::vector调用swap成员函数高效交换;④指针管理的动态数组可通过交换指针优化性能。
这种方法不仅保证了代码的安全性,提高了可读性和可维护性,也使得系统能够轻松应对不断变化的业务逻辑需求。
基本上就这些。
它们常用于异步操作的结果传递。
在 Laravel 5.4 的特定上下文中,闭包内部的 $this 可能指向的是不同的对象(例如 ParameterBag),而不是我们期望的当前模型实例或请求中的 id。
Go的这种自包含特性带来了极大的部署便利性,使得Go程序可以轻松地打包到Docker容器中,或直接部署到服务器上而无需担心环境配置问题。
这个仓库会通过依赖注入接收一个DBClient接口。
使用docker-compose.yml可引入数据库或消息队列等依赖服务。
反射操作中匿名与具名结构体字段的识别技巧 在反射的世界里,区分匿名结构体字段和普通具名结构体字段,是进行精确操作的关键。
适合树形结构中父子节点共享子节点的情况。
在 typing 模块中的 override 函数定义中,我们可以看到这种新语法的应用,例如 def override[F: type](method: F, /) -> F:...。
抵御XML解析DoS攻击的策略主要集中在对解析器行为的严格限制: 限制实体扩展: 这是防范Billion Laughs攻击的核心。
PHP程序的重启,在我看来,其实并不是直接“重启PHP程序”本身,而是重启承载它运行的环境或服务。
Go语言标准库中的 compress/gzip 包提供了对Gzip格式数据进行压缩和解压缩的功能。
立即学习“PHP免费学习笔记(深入)”; 1. 包含计算和分类的实现 以下是结合了数学计算和条件分类的PHP函数示例。
基本语法包括参数包(parameter pack)和展开操作(...)。

本文链接:http://www.roselinjean.com/361913_9752b8.html